英文简介 | There are close interactions among soil fertility, microorganisms and plants. Microorganisms could produce plant growth-regulating substances and supply nutrients in plant rhizosphere; moreover, plants could adjust their defense and growth according to the type of microorganisms. Thus, it has been a focus of attention that how to analyze and exploit the interaction mechanisms between microbes and plants in agricultural production. Nitrogen is one of the most important nutrient elements in plant growth. Plants obtain nitrogen relying mainly on the nitrogen-fixing microbes in natural ecosystems. Among them, the free-living nitrogen fixing bacteria can independently fix nitrogen in soil. It is also one of the hot spot in microbial research that how to activate the free-living nitrogen fixing bacteria, and thus enhance the nitrogen content of arable soil. The project focuses on analyzing the temporal and spatial dynamics of the diversity and activity between the total soil bacteria and the free-living nitrogen fixing bacteria in semi-arid land; and investigating the arable land management measures as well as the interaction mechanism between crop growth and soil microorganisms through the use of the different land management measures. The project could provide the scientific support for the reasonable agricultural production measures in the semi-arid land. |
